Can a self-proclaimed misandrist and a potential chauvinist ever find common ground?

Asha Avery lives a quiet life away from the grandeur afforded her by her family’s wealth. Her past is littered with pain, sadness and the most unlikely avenues of revenge. To cope, she studies the mind hoping to rid the world of its ills and to fix what she believes is broken within her.
Ori Nakoa is a man on the verge of claiming his position within the
Consortium. For years he’s been an agent of the machine but retirement is on the horizon. His father’s death and mother’s abandonment ensured that few made it into his inner circle and he’s content with the way his life is.
And then one night changed both of their worlds.

Ori and Asha are thrown together into an arrangement which causes them to constantly battle for control. Forced to live together, work together and tasked to build a connection neither of them wants. Will they find that their differences aren’t so insurmountable and love not an impossibility or will they allow past pains to keep them isolated while their chance at happiness crashes and burns?
